What is the simplest form of the quotient 4 square root 810 over 4 square root 2

Answer:


3\sqrt[4]{5}

Explanation:

Given:
\frac{\sqrt[4]{810} }{\sqrt[4]{2} }

Top and bottom has fourth root. so we take fourth root in common


\sqrt[4]{(810)/(2) }

When we divide 810 by 2. we will get 405


\sqrt[4]{405}

Now we simplify the fourth root

405 can be written as 3*3*3*3*5


\sqrt[4]{3*3*3*3*5}


3\sqrt[4]{5}
